This website has been created as an introductary unit for use by jazz students and educators. The project was initiated through faculty and students of Boise State University's Department of Music and the Gene Harris Jazz Festival to aid in Jazz Education. The website focuses on orientating students to the cultural, political, and social events that occurred in each era associated with jazz and also to several artists, who's lives and music influenced the direction of jazz as it evolved.
We have selected a number of musicians from several styles and periods to give students a starting point for listening and exploring jazz. This list is representational of these styles but not conclusive. We encourage teachers and students to expand their listening beyond this list as you see fit.
